Overview

The Mersen K302091 Protistor® Size 72 gR high-speed fuse-link (SKU K302091) is a precision-engineered component designed for superior semiconductor protection in demanding power conversion applications. This square body fuse-link features flush ends with metric threads and is rated for 350A continuous current with a breaking capacity of 150kA at 600VDC/650VDC, meeting both IEC 650VDC and UL 600VDC standards. Constructed with pure silver fuse elements die-cut and embedded in solidified sand, the K302091 achieves exceptional arc control, resulting in lower I²t values for enhanced protection of sensitive components including diodes, thyristors, GTOs, and IGBTs. All contact surfaces are silver-plated for optimal conductivity, while non-magnetic hardware ensures long-term reliability in critical systems. The integrated striker mechanism enables low-voltage trip signaling through a field-mountable microswitch, providing immediate fault indication without manual inspection. With a pre-arcing I²t of 23.2 kA²s and clearing I²t of 140 kA²s, this fuse-link delivers precise fault response while maintaining high interrupting ratings. The metric threaded terminals ensure secure installation in equipment layouts requiring precise dimensional control. Part of Mersen's Protistor® series, the K302091 offers engineers flexibility in system design while providing the ultimate protection for high-power semiconductor applications where failure is not an option.

POWR-JAW clamps improve the contact between fuse and clip. The unnecessary heat from poor contact due to the loss of spring force in the clips can cause nuisance fuse opening and premature aging of surrounding components. What accessories are available for Mersen products?

Mersen offers multiple accessories for their fuse blocks and systems, including safety pullers (DFC3M and DFC3LP), DIN-rail adapters (DRM), bus bars, auxiliary contacts, and specialized mounting hardware. Key accessories include the DFC3M safety puller for 1-1/2" x 13/32" midget or Class CC fuses, the DRM adapter for mounting 303 series fuse blocks on DIN-rail, and UltraSafe fuse module accessories like bus bars and auxiliary contacts that enable module interconnection and monitoring.
